SharePoint MVP klepet na sre 04/20

Jaz bom sodelujejo v enem obdobju MVP klepeti naslednji teden, 04/20.  Tukaj je napisati-up Microsofta in link za registracijo:

Imate težko tehnična vprašanja glede SharePoint, za katerega ste iščejo odgovore? Ali želite, da pokrije globoko poznavanje je nadarjen Microsoft Most Valuable Professionals? SharePoint MVP-ji so isti ljudje, vidite v tehnične Skupnosti kot avtorji, zvočniki, vodje skupin uporabnikov in answerers v MSDN ter TechNet forumih. Z ljudski prošnja, smo prinesli ti strokovnjaki skupaj kot kolektivna skupina odgovoriti na vaša vprašanja v živo. Torej prosim, Pridružite se nam in prinašajo na vprašanja! Ta klepet bo zajemal WSS 3.0, MOSS, SharePoint Foundation 2010 in SharePoint Server 2010. Teme vključujejo setup in uprava, Design, razvoj in splošno vprašanje.
Prosim, pridružite sem nam na sreda 20 April 9 PDT/opoldne EST za klepet z MVP-ji iz po vsem svetu. Več in ti klepeti dodati koledar z obiskom strani MSDN dogodek http://msdn.microsoft.com/en-us/events/aa497438.aspx

Sem se pridružil v eni od teh lani in je bilo resnično curka.  To je samo nor neke odprto vprašanje/odgovor Ekstravaganca. 

Tukaj je nekaj v (trenutno) seznama SharePoint MVP udeležencev:

Cornelius van Dyk
Dan Attis
Daniel zlitega večstopenjskega
David Martos
Ivan Sanders
Jeremy Thake
John Ross
Kris Wagner
Mike Oryszak
Randy Drisgill
Lesenih  Windischman
Zlatan Dzinic

To je širok spekter interesov in specialitete.  Mislim, da to bo zabavno časa in dobro izkoristiti svoje kosilo uro (ali vsako uro podnevi Smile )

Prijavite tukaj (http://msdn.microsoft.com/en-us/events/aa497438.aspx).

</namen>

Naročite se na moj blog.

Sledite mi na Cvrkutati na http://www.twitter.com/pagalvin

Eden od razlogov za "eno ali več polj vrste ni pravilno nameščen”

Sem bil včeraj kar majhno poteg za spletni gradnik, ki počne CAML poizvedbo proti seznam.  Naredila sem spremembo, jo in dobil zadetek z napako:

Nepričakovana napaka v treh dan Outlook vremena spletnega gradnika. Se obrnite na skrbnika sistema. Nekatere vrste polj niso nameščene pravilno. Pojdite na stran z nastavitvami seznama želite izbrisati ta polja.

Sem bil obrnjen drugo vprašanje Otkačen prej, zato nisem takoj povezati moj CAML poizvedbe z napako, da SharePoint je poročanje, da me.  Sem storil a nagel preiskava bing in in našel to koristen blog post z Posut s peskom Nahta  (http://snahta.blogspot.com/2009/01/one-or-more-field-types-are-not.html).

Tukaj je slabo poizvedbe:

poizvedbe.Poizvedovanje ="<Kjer><In><NEQ><FieldRef ime = "Abbr" /><Vrednost Type = "Besedilo">SFNY</Vrednost><FieldRef ime = "Abbr" /><Vrednost Type = "Besedilo">SFIS</Vrednost></NEQ></In></Kjer>";

Tukaj je določen:

poizvedbe.Poizvedovanje ="<Kjer><In><NEQ><FieldRef ime = "Abbr" /><Vrednost Type = "Besedilo">SFNY</Vrednost></NEQ><NEQ><FieldRef ime = "Abbr" /><Vrednost Type = "Besedilo">SFIS</Vrednost></NEQ></In></Kjer>";

Tako, moralno te zgodbe je: Poskrbite, da vaš CAML je pravilna ali morda boste dobili napako Otkačen.

Naročite se na moj blog.

Sledite mi na Cvrkutati na http://www.twitter.com/pagalvin

</namen>

Hitri popravki za "je prišlo do napake pri nalaganju obrazca”

Sem testiranje po meri SharePoint Designer 2010 dejavnost fine nedeljo popoldne in bil nepričakovano hitting "Kritična napaka" čas težaven v splavitev potek dela:

Prišlo je do napake med nalaganjem obrazca.

Kliknite Start Over naložiti novo kopijo obrazca.  Če se napaka ponovi, obrnite na skupino za podporo za spletno mesto.

Kliknite Zapri, da zaprete to sporočilo.

Pokaži podrobnosti o napaki

seveda, Če kliknete gumb "Pokaži podrobnosti o napaki" vse kar naredi je pokazal ID korelacije:

image

V mojem primeru, to obrnjen jasno v obstati nadomestne preslikave dostopa problem.  Sem pogledal na dnevniške datoteke v na 14 panja in videl, da InfoPath pritoževal nad AAM vprašanje (ker je bil hitting localhost namesto ime strežnika).  Sem spremenil svoj URL in ki ga rešiti.

To does pokazati, da z vse linkings različnih bitov zdaj v SP 2010, stvar ste seveda to je problem (Poteka dela programa SharePoint Designer, v mojem primeru) je dejansko popolnoma nepovezane jedro problema.

Naročite se na moj blog.

Sledite mi na Cvrkutati na http://www.twitter.com/pagalvin

</namen>

SharePoint 2010 Raztopina, ki je zaljubljen v "uvajanje” Stanje

Sem se PowerShell uvajanje rešitev za SharePoint kmetije (h/t:  Corey Roth in njegov blog post). 

Potem sem šel na osrednji admin, dostopati sistem nastavitve in nato »Upravljanje kmetij rešitve« za uvajanje, na kmetiji in da moj (rahle) osuplost, dobila zaljubljen v "uvajanje".

Videl sem to vprašanje, ki je prišel večkrat na MSDN forumi, Torej sem bil zelo živčen približno to.  Jaz preiskava okrog a košček in našel to koristen članek (navidezno unattributed oseba iz http://www.resolutionsnet.co.uk/).  I razveljavi uvajanje delo, in ko sem kliknil v raztopino, to mi je povedal, da je imel uspešno uveden rešitev za tri od štirih strežnike v gruči.

Šla sem na Zabludjeli strežnik, ustavi časovnik storitev in ga zaženete.  Windows server dejansko povedal mi da storitvi ni uspelo odzvati ukaz, tako da mi je povedal, da je bolan.

tokrat, Ko sem šel nazaj na osrednji admin, Sem mogel razposlati brez problema.

Upajmo ta bit info bo pomagal nekaj v vezava, ena dni.

</namen>

Naročite se na moj blog.

Sledite mi na Cvrkutati na http://www.twitter.com/pagalvin

Napaka na dan: "Ne morete dodati navedenega zbirnika v GAC”

Jaz sem bil boj proti malo z visual studio 2010 na a sp2010 rešitev in je bil pridobivanje to zmota:

Napaka v programu uvajanja korak "Dodaj rešitev": Napaka: Navedenega zbirnika ni mogoče dodati predpomnilnik globalnega zbira: YourAwesomeDLLThat IAmJustNotGoingToInstallRightNow.dll

Šla sem na GAC, sama (c:\windowsassembly) poskusiti in odstranite ter got zmota »pila v rabi«.

Sem storil je iisreset, Jaz downloaded skoraj Sysinternals, Ustavil sem se storitev razporejevalnika storitev... končno, Sem pravkar zaprli in ponovno odprli visual studio, sama in mi je končno uspelo blizu to jasno.

</namen>

Naročite se na moj blog.

Sledite mi na Cvrkutati na http://www.twitter.com/pagalvin

Hitro in enostavno: Debugging VS 2010 Raztopina uvajanje

Visual Studio 2010 poročila težko debug napak med uvajanjem nekaj krat.  Hiter in enostaven način za nekatere zelo grobo debugging je vrgel svoj imenovan izjeme.  Visual Studio jim pokazati v izhod konzole.

Razmislite o tem malo kodo:

image

Če ta funkcija je v obsegu do spletnih aplikacij, stran bo biti ničen.  Če poskusite in referenčne nepremičnine strani, boste dobili dvoumen napaka:

Napaka v programu uvajanja korak "Dodaj rešitev": Referenčni objekt ni nastavljena na primer predmeta.

Vendar, Če vrgel novo izjema ter prelaz niz gradbenik, boste dobili nekoliko bolj koristen sporočilo:

image

To je surovo tehnika, vendar zelo hitro in enostavno.

</namen>

Naročite se na moj blog.

Sledite mi na Cvrkutati na http://www.twitter.com/pagalvin

Časovnik Job FeatureActivated in funkcija področje

Sem delal z nekaj kodo, da nekdo izroči me za časovnik zaposlitev.  On ni določeno dejansko funkcija activation zbornik, tako sem napisati to, seveda.  Sem vzel prednost Andrew Connell slaven blog post na predmet.

Uporabljam Visual Studio 2010 in uvajanje kept nezadosten z napako "Napaka v programu uvajanja korak"Dodaj rešitev": Predmet sklic ne nastavite primerek predmeta. «

Bil ob svojo kodo preveč dobesedno.  Sem bil določanje funkcijo na ravni spletne aplikacije, kot je prikazano:

image

Kot posledica, lastnosti, ki so poslana sprejemnik, so iz web aplikacije, ne zbirke mest.  Na koncu, to izgleda zakonika:

javno preglasitve neveljavne FeatureActivated(SPFeatureReceiverProperties lastnosti)
{

    // Ne, naredite to s web app, z obsegom funkcij, vodi do obup Smile
    // SPSite stran = lastnosti.Feature.Parent kot SPSite;

    SPWebApplication wa = lastnosti.Feature.Parent kot SPWebApplication;

    Če (wa == null) met novo izjema("webapp2 je ničelna.");

    foreach (SPJobDefinition delo v wa.JobDefinitions)
    {

        poskusite
        {
            Če (delo.Ime == List_JOB_NAME)

                delo.Brisanje();
        }
        ulova (Izjema e)
        {
            met novo izjema("marker 2");
        } // ulov izjemo e
    }

    // namestite delo

    WeatherForecastTimerJob weatherForecastTimerJob =
        novo WeatherForecastTimerJob(List_JOB_NAME, wa);

    SPMinuteSchedule urnik = nov SPMinuteSchedule();
    urnik.BeginSecond = 0;
    urnik.EndSecond = 59;
    urnik.Interval = 5;
    weatherForecastTimerJob.Schedule = urnik;
    weatherForecastTimerJob.Update();

}

Ključ, ki je prevzem proč je, da ko funkcija je v obsegu web app, SPFeatureReceiverProperties, da SharePoint prehaja sprejemnik funkcija je web app ravni parametrov.  Andrew's stari blog vpis predpostavlja, da je v obsegu zbirke mest.

</namen>

Naročite se na moj blog.

Sledite mi na Cvrkutati na http://www.twitter.com/pagalvin

Posodobitev CodePlex projekta: SharePoint Designer potek dela razširitve

Nekaj časa nazaj, I napisal da je poskušal uskrsnuti moj stari CodePlex projekt, SharePoint Designer potek dela razširitve.  Da CodePlex projekta je bila razvita za WSS in MOSS in dodaja peščica pripomoček vrsto funkcije, kot "ToLower()”, "ToUpper()”, "Podniz()"in tako naprej.  Treba je tudi splošni namen "klic spletna storitev" slog funkcija.  Si lahko preberete več o tem tukaj: http://paulgalvinsoldblog.wordpress.com/2007/10/28/sharepoint-designer-custom-activity-to-execute-user-defined-c-functions/.

Sem bolj ali manj ga opustila precej časa nazaj.  Odkar SharePoint 2010 prišel ven., vendar, Sem že smislu pogled nazaj na to in da je delo v SP 2010.  Dobro, danes, Sem samo to.  Niso posodobljene kodo za CodePlex še. Želim izobraževati sebe na CodePlex konvencij, preden je to storil, vendar posodobim naredil domačo stran wiki za projekt.

Posledice za širši in bolj zanimivo je, da meri dejavnosti iz WSS in MOSS zdi, da pristanišče nad zelo enostavno, ki je a (dobrodošli) presenečenje mi.

Evo, kako izgleda v SharePoint Designer ko deluje:

image

</namen>

Naročite se na moj blog.

Sledite mi na Cvrkutati na http://www.twitter.com/pagalvin

Kjer je Microsoft.SharePoint.ApplicationPages.Administration.dll?

Sem bil izroči visual studio projekta, ki se sklicuje na Microsoft.SharePoint.ApplicationPages.Administration.dll.  Rabil sem malo medtem ko iskanje misel in bi delež.  Moje okolje, nahaja se na:

c:\program filescommon filesmicrosoft sharedweb server extensions14configadminbin

</namen>

Naročite se na moj blog.

Sledite mi na Cvrkutati na http://www.twitter.com/pagalvin

BrightStarr ZDA iščejo SharePoint analitik

Moje podjetje, BrightStarr, išče SharePoint business analyst.  Naš cilj je delati z nekom, ki:

  • Zelo dobro razume platformi
  • Ima dobro idejo, kaj je pametna rešitev SharePoint versus tlakovana skupaj hišo iz kart
  • Uživa delajo neposredno strankam, Nekateri jim razumeti, kaj je vse o SharePoint in nekateri, ki imajo samo nejasen pojem, da bi lahko SharePoint, ki jim pomagajo, vendar ne vem točno kako
  • Znam zelo dobro
  • Lahko res dobro komunicirati majhna skupina
  • Dobro in uživa večopravilnosti.  To je ne močno poganja proces okolje (imamo dovolj proces uganjati stvari na organiziran način, vendar smo zelo hitro na naše noge, okretna in vse, kar dobre stvari).

To ni a razvijalec položaj, čeprav če ste svetovalec-razvijalec išče osredotočiti bolj ali svetovanje in manj na razvoj, To je lahko dober korak za vas.

Če vas zanima, ping me na Cvrkutati ali email mi!

</namen>

Naročite se na moj blog.

Sledite mi na Cvrkutati na http://www.twitter.com/pagalvin